A photo frame weighing 4.16 newtons is hanging by a wire making an angle with the horizontal. The tension experienced by both wires is 3 newtons. What angle is made by both wires with the horizontal?

A. 13.7Âș
B. 24.3Âș
C. 43.9Âș
D. 45.4Âș
E. 49.2Âș

Answer: option C. 43.9°

Explanation:

Refer to the diagram. The tension in the two strings is equal T₁=T₂=T = 3 N

The strings support a frame weighing, W= 4.26 N

We will write the tension in the strings as the sum of their horizontal and vertical components.

The horizontal components balance each other and cancel out.

T₁ cos ξ = T₂ cos ξ  

On the other hand, The vertical component would support the weight of the frame.

2 T sin Ξ = W

2 × 3 N × sin ξ = 4.16 N

sin Ξ = 0.693

⇒ Ξ = sin ⁻Âč(0.693)  = 43.9°

Hence, the angle made by two wires with the horizontal is 43.9°.
